Tartalomjegyzék:

Arduino alapú MIDI harcos (érintésérzékeny): 7 lépés (képekkel)
Arduino alapú MIDI harcos (érintésérzékeny): 7 lépés (képekkel)

Videó: Arduino alapú MIDI harcos (érintésérzékeny): 7 lépés (képekkel)

Videó: Arduino alapú MIDI harcos (érintésérzékeny): 7 lépés (képekkel)
Videó: MIDI kontroller készítés arduinoval 2024, Július
Anonim
Arduino alapú MIDI harcos (érintésérzékeny)
Arduino alapú MIDI harcos (érintésérzékeny)

A MIDI a Musical Instrument Digital Interface rövidítése. Itt érintésérzékeny MIDI vadászgépet készítünk.

16 párnája van. ezek növelhetők vagy csökkenthetők. Itt 16 -ot használtam a korlátozott arduino csapok miatt.

Továbbá analóg bemeneti csapokat (A0, A1, A2, A3, A4) használtam digitális bemenetként.

Ez az első tanítható. Úgyhogy elnézést minden tévedésért. Korábban nem gondoltam arra, hogy oktathatót készítsek.

szóval nem sok részletes fényképem van erről.

Van egy működő videó a MIDI -ről, amelyet a videóban szereplő ableton live 9 szoftverben választottam ki hangként.

1. lépés: A szükséges anyagok összegyűjtése

A következőkre lesz szüksége:

  1. Arduino uno R3 (1 egység)
  2. 1Mohm ellenállás (16 egység)
  3. Általános arduino pajzs (1 egység)
  4. Alufólia
  5. Műanyag/akril lemez (külső testhez)
  6. Potenciométer (1 egység)
  7. vezetékek
  8. Fekete szalag

A használt eszközök a következők:

  1. Fúró
  2. Vágóeszköz
  3. Forrasztópáka
  4. Forró ragasztó

Ezek a kellékek szükségesek a MIDI vadászgép gyártásához. Van egy általános célú arduino pajzsom az ellenállásokhoz.

de használhat általános célú PCB -t.

2. lépés: A külső test elkészítése

A külső test elkészítéséhez műanyag lapra lesz szüksége.

vágja le a lapot a megadott méretre:

felül és alul (200 x 200 mm)

4 oldalra (200 x 40 mm)

most vágjon 16 lyukat a felső lapra, hogy átadja a párnák vezetékeit. Egy nyílás az arduino csatlakozó egyik oldalán.

Csatlakoztassa ezeket a darabokat, hogy négyzet alakú legyen, kivéve a tetejét. A párnák alumínium fóliából készülnek.

vágjon le 16 lapot 45 x 45 mm méretű alumínium fóliából.

A fúrt lyukaknak a betét helyétől függően kell lenniük.

3. lépés: Kapcsolatok

Kapcsolatok
Kapcsolatok

a csatlakozásokat a képen látható módon kell elvégezni.

A potenciométer az érintés érzékenységét szolgálja. Az érintési érzékenység beállítására szolgál.

MEGJEGYZÉS: A használandó vezetékeknek azonos típusúaknak kell lenniük. Ellenkező esetben eltérés lehet a kapacitív értékekben.

próbálja meg azonos méretű vezetékeket is elkészíteni.

4. lépés: Végső összeszerelés

Végső összeszerelés
Végső összeszerelés
Végső összeszerelés
Végső összeszerelés
Végső összeszerelés
Végső összeszerelés

Most össze kell kapcsolnunk mind az elektronikai, mind a hardver alkatrészeket. Először csatlakoztassa az alumínium fóliát a felső réteghez egyenlő távolságra, és csatlakoztassa a vezetékeket az egyes fóliákhoz. Ezután a vezetékeket az arduino -hoz kell csatlakoztatni, mint a 2. lépésben.

A fóliát ragasztóval vagy szalaggal ragaszthatja.

a kartondarabokat a műanyag és a fólia közé is teheti, hogy vastagságot és jó érzést biztosítson.

MEGJEGYZÉS: A vezetékeket folyamatosan csatlakoztatni kell a fóliához.

5. lépés: A kód feltöltése az Arduino -ba

a kód itt található.

töltsd fel az arduino -ba.

MEGJEGYZÉS: amikor kódot tölt fel az arduino -ba, a szőrtelen midi soros portját úgy kell beállítani, hogy ne legyen csatlakoztatva. ellenkező esetben a kód feltöltése közben megjelenik a hiba.

itt a kód az érintőpad teszteléséhez és a tőkés érzékelő értékek lekéréséhez (captouch16try.ino)

a tesztkód megadja az érzékelő értékeit.

ezeknek az értékeknek közel azonosnak kell lenniük. különben a pad nem fog megfelelően működni.

a megadott értékek a másik kód érzékenysége lesznek.

6. lépés: Szoftverkövetelmények

Szoftverkövetelmény
Szoftverkövetelmény
Szoftverkövetelmény
Szoftverkövetelmény

Töltse le ezeket a szoftvereket:

  1. Ableton Live 9 lakosztály
  2. Szőrtelen MIDI sorozat
  3. LoopMIDi

Az Ableton letölthető a hivatalos webhelyről.

Github link a szőrtelen midi letöltéséhez:

(https://projectgus.github.io/hairless-midiserial/)

Link a loopmidi -hez:

www.tobias-erichsen.de/wp-content/uploads/2…

Töltse le és telepítse ezeket a szoftvereket.

kovesd ezeket a lepeseket:

1. lépés.

nyissa meg a LoopMIDI programot, és kattintson a (+) gombra a bal alsó sarokban.

Port jön létre az adatátvitelhez.

2. lépés.

Nyissa meg a szőrtelen midi -t, most válassza ki a loopmidiport -ot a midi kimenetben.

hagyja a midi -t csatlakoztatva.

válassza ki az arduino soros portját (ez akkor jelenik meg, ha az arduino számítógéphez/laptophoz csatlakozik)

3. lépés.

futás ableton élőben 9.

nyissa meg a beállításokat (ctrl +,)

most válassza ki a link midi -t a bal oldali oszlopban, és válassza ki a beállítást a képen látható módon.

csukd be azt az ablakot

4. lépés.

most válassza ki a dobokat a bal oldali második oszlopban.

válasszon ki egy dobot.

amikor a dob van kiválasztva.

és megérinti a midi padot, hangot ad ki a laptopja.

A MIDI harcos elkészült.

Élvezd!!!:-)

7. lépés: Hibaelhárítás

A szoftverek nincsenek megfelelően konfigurálva.

előtte lesz némi probléma az érintés beállításával, mivel a pad analóg értékeket ad, és ezek az értékek problémát okozhatnak.

előfordulhat, hogy a vezetékek nincsenek megfelelően csatlakoztatva.

fólia nem érinti megfelelően a vezetéket.

vezetékek rövidre záródhatnak.

Ajánlott: